Buying Guide
What should I look for in a thin emerald-cut diamond band?
Key factors include metal type (white vs. yellow gold), whether the center stone is lab-grown or mined, total carat weight, and band width. Emerald-cut stones emphasize clarity and step facets, so VVS to VS clarity and near-colorless grades improve perceived brilliance in a slim setting.
Is lab-grown diamond acceptable for a fine jewelry piece?
Lab-grown diamonds are visually and physically comparable to mined stones, with popular options in the list offering E-F color and VS2-SI1 clarity. Lab-grown options often provide ethical sourcing and potentially cost savings, allowing for a larger look within a slim profile.
How does a thin band affect durability and daily wear?
A thinner band can be more prone to bending or catching on objects. Choose solid gold or a high-quality alloy with proper setting protection for constant wear. Pave or multiple-stone designs may require more maintenance than a single-stone eternity band.
Should I choose white gold or yellow gold?
White gold offers a contemporary look that matches most modern jewelry stacks, especially with colorless diamonds. Yellow gold provides a warm, classic tone and can highlight certain skin tones. Consider existing pieces in your collection to ensure cohesive styling.
What does “eternity band” mean for sizing and comfort?
An eternity band typically features stones around the full band, which can affect fit and comfort for everyday wear. If you plan to stack with a solitaire or other rings, verify whether the band’s width and profile complement your other pieces.

- Can I resize these thin bands? Many thin eternity or solitaire bands are difficult to resize. Check the listing or contact the seller for size-specific guidance.
- What is the typical care for emerald-cut diamonds? Clean with mild soap and a soft brush, and avoid harsh chemicals that may affect the finish of plated metals.
- Which setting best protects the emerald cut? A secure solitaire or partial bezel setting tends to protect the long edges of an emerald-cut stone better in daily wear.
